Dead Cells has its final update out now with The End is Near

www.gamingonlinux.com

@simple@lemm.ee to Games@lemmy.worldEnglish • 9 months ago
message-square
21
fedilink
Six years after the main release, Dead Cells has seen it's final update, packed full of content to give it a good send off.
